THE MAKER

The Maker tells the story of Drexel, an idealist inventor, and Pipe, his quietly brilliant servant, as they try to invent something extraordinary— from absolutely nothing.

The Maker invites audiences into a world full of visual surprises, physical comedy, and strange magical experiments that teeter between brilliance and disaster. 


From the team that created the world-touring hit show A Very Old Man with Enormous Wings and Barabbas co-founder Raymond Keane, comes this brilliantly playful new show taking inspiration from Beckett, Borges, and Buster Keaton.

Age range: 6 -10
